Bob Bakker

Bob Bakker is a famous paleontologist who has helped re-shape modern theories about dinosaurs, particularly by adding support to the theory that some dinosaurs were homeothermic (warm-blooded).

His appearance is distinguished by his large cowboy hat, and his huge beard.


He wrote the book Raptor Red (ISBN 0785799729), portraying a female UtahRaptor during a time of environmental change in proto-North America.
